Meetings, meetings, meetings. Ahh! Working in a virtual environment can be overwhelming. Often, you’re not able to take a break, let alone eat lunch without interruption. With an increase in responsibilities, changes in the community, and juggling your kids and significant other, sometimes you just need a mental escape. Music is that escape. Intently being wrapped in a song can take you from your current circumstance, to a party on a beach in Santa Barbara. Being aware of your mental health needs is critical to your self-care. Like the flight attendant says, you must put your mask on before assisting others.

Bask into the magic of music this summer and let all of your worries slip away. Start with this list of dancing gems to get your groove on!
